An Update on Business Plans – Doing our Part in Chicago, Illinois

A letter to our clients, partners, employees, and the overall community:

Access One’s top priority is and has always been to serve our community— which includes our clients, our partners, and our employees. By now you’re aware that the only way we can preserve the health of our community is taking any action we can to slow the transmission of coronavirus (COVID-19).

Effective today, March 18th, Access One is transitioning to a remote-work-from-home model until further notice.  We‘ve also stopped all business related travel (our techs will still dispatch at this time). Prior to this decision we ensured our team has the required resources to fully do their jobs from home— just as if they were at our office.

Our commitment to our clients stands strong. We intend to keep providing our award-winning client experience all while prioritizing the health and safety of our team and our community.

We’ve had to run our business remotely in the past — and have teams set up for 24/7 availability (just as we always do). We will maintain our usual levels of client support.

It’s our responsibility to keep you informed of any changes that may impact how you work with all of us at Access One. If necessary, we will reach out directly as well as update this web page and our corporate social media channels.

As a business technology and communications service provider, we’re in a very fortunate position to be able to pivot so quickly. We acknowledge that not every organization is able to make this change so fast. Our team is here to support you any way we can.
